About the job

The Salesforce Technical Administrator at Flight Centre Travel Group plays a vital role in supporting, optimising, and maintaining a global multi-cloud Salesforce environment. This job is all about ensuring smooth operations and compliance while collaborating with architects, developers, and support teams. The team thrives on inclusivity and innovation, creating an environment where everyone can contribute and grow.

You'll be responsible for

⚙️

Configuring and maintaining solutions

Configure and maintain scalable solutions using Salesforce tools such as Flows, validation rules, custom objects, record types, and Lightning pages
📈

Aligning business processes

Align business processes with Salesforce best practices and help ensure solutions deliver measurable business benefits
🧪

Managing sandbox environments

Manage sandbox environments, prepare deployment packages, and participate in release readiness activities

Skills you'll need

🛠️

Salesforce Administration

4+ years Salesforce Administration experience supporting enterprise-scale environments
📜

Salesforce Administrator Certification

Salesforce Administrator Certification (required); Advanced Admin or Platform App Builder preferred
🔍

Attention to detail

Exceptional attention to detail, documentation, and governance discipline
